ZIP 73944 and ZIP 73950 are ZIP Code areas in Oklahoma.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 73950 has the higher population (1,342 vs 459 in ZIP 73944). ZIP 73944 has the higher median household income ($84,844 vs $66,607 in ZIP 73950). ZIP 73950 has the higher median home value ($137,500 vs $48,000 in ZIP 73944).
